- 博客(4)
- 收藏
- 关注
原创 python基础班第十四课
python基础班第十四课 单例模式 new()方法: # _new_() # 创建和返回一个类(object)在类准备自身实例化时使用 class A(object): print('我是类中的代码') def __init__(self): print('我是init') a =A() # _new_() # 创建和返回一个类(object)在类准备自身实例化时使用 class A(object): # print('我是类中的代码')
2021-02-28 01:16:06 104 1
原创 python基础班第十三课
python基础班第十三课 上次没讲的property装饰器 class Person(): def __init__(self,name): self._name = name @property def name(self): # get查询方法 print('get方法执行了') return self._name p =Person('哈哈') print(p.name()) class Person(): de
2021-02-25 22:02:12 189
原创 python基础班12课
python基础班第12课 复习 class MyClass(): # 定义类 图纸 color ='red' # 属性 def yanse(self):# 方法 行为 print('车子是红色的') mc =MyClass() #对象 类的实例化 print(mc.color) mc.yanse() ''' 面向过程 1.打开门 2.装大象 3.关门 ''' ''' 面向对象(.后面是方法def) 1.冰箱.开门 2.冰箱.存储 3.冰箱.关门 ''' class
2021-02-23 22:56:26 76
原创 python基础班第十一课
python基础班第十一课 列表推导式 生成器 迭代器 对象的简介 类的简介 类的使用 上次作业详解 复习 列表推导式 # 推导式 列表推导式 # 用简单代码创建一个新列表 # [表达式 for 变量 in 旧列表] # [表达式 for 变量 in 旧列表 if 条件] lst1 =['cheney','tony','jerry','amy','juran'] def fun(): new_lst =[] for name in lst1: if len(name) &
2021-02-05 22:26:08 139
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人